Pasta with Mixed Wild Mushroom Sauce

Pasta with Mixed Wild Mushroom Sauce is a modern British recipe (based on an Italian original) for a classic dish of linguine or spaghetti served with a tomato and wild mushroom sauce flavoured with anchovies. Though just about any type of pasta can be used this dish works particularly well with linguine or spaghetti. Instead of a mixture of wild mushrooms you could use just ceps (penny buns) or any Agaricus species (field mushrooms and allies).

Ingredients:

400g linguine or spaghetti
100ml extra-virgin olive oil
3 garlic cloves, chopped
1 tsp dried oregano
300g ripe tomatoes, blanched, peeled, de-seeded and chopped
salt and freshly-ground black pepper, to taste
400g mixed wild mushrooms, sliced
4 anchovy fillets, chopped

Method:

Bring a pan of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ook for about 15 minutes (or according to the package instructions) until al dente. You will need to time the pasta so it’s ready at the same time as the sauce.

Meanwhile, heat the oil in a large pa. Add the garlic and oregano and fry for 2 minutes. Stir through the tomatoes and continue cooking for 15 minutes.

Season to taste with salt and freshly-ground black pepper then stir in the mushrooms and anchovies.

Continue cooking the sauce over low heat until the mushrooms are tender (the exact time will depend on the species that you’ve chosen, though most will need at least 5–10 minutes cooking time and some will need up to 20 minutes).

Drain the cooked pasta, transfer to a warmed serving dish then pour over the sauce and serve.
